hello!! as an online college student, iβve been lucky enough to already have some experience with online schooling, so iβm here to offer all my advice for the students of quarantined schools! due to the covid-19 outbreak, itβs been very difficult for many whoβve had to switch to online school. however, there are many way to make it simpler and faster, and iβm here to give my best tips!!
firstly, make a list. whether youβre more comfortable with a physical to-do list or a virtual calendar to schedule things out (iβve used google calendar almost my whole life but i just got the app elisi and itβs beautiful, minimalist, and easy to use! available on pretty much every device). planning out your work is the most efficient way to get it done.
donβt try to do everything at once. while itβs best to get things done soon, space out your work efficiently so you donβt feel overwhelmed!
create a simple, comfortable study space. it doesnβt have to be a perfectly organized desk or gorgeous setup at the kitchen table; i do all of my college work from my bed with a comfy throw blanket and fairy lights up. the most important thing is that you are in the right position to do work, you are comfortable, and that you are able to keep everything you need close to you.
work in chunks. to best knock out your work, take it an hour at a time with 10 to 15 minute breaks in between. make some tea, get a snack, stay energized.
drink lots of water. you are not immune to the coronavirus. itβs also easier to stay energized and focused when youβre hydrated.
MOST IMPORTANTLY: COMMUNICATE WITH YOUR INSTRUCTORS. at first i was very timid to communicate back and forth with my professors when something was wrong but i have learned that it is the most important thing to have good communication. if you donβt understand a concept, have trouble with the online system, or just need general help in your academics, sending them an email is the best way to solve the problem.
reward yourself!! once youβve finished an assignment, give yourself a little treat (maybe a half hour of minecraft or your favorite snack to munch on!!)βitβs the best way to encourage your mind to work harder.
donβt work too late. youβre off from school. unless itβs the night of the due date, donβt push yourself until itβs done. the morning is just a sleep away.

another important tip! communicate with your classmates in case you donβt understand something. everybody learns differently and some pick up info different than others.Β
make fancy notes!! get fancy with your stationery!! you have plenty of time now and can go bonkers with your beautiful notes.
continue to check your temperature and monitor symptoms. your school has closed for a reason. your safety and health are important.
retain a relatively normal sleep schedule, similar to the one you have when you normally go to school. slipping out of your regular sleep cycle can and will kick your ass when itβs time to go back.
lastly, eat breakfast, lunch, and dinner. take a nap when youβre tired. remember to go to the bathroom and keep your water filled. take care of yourself.
